Several tests on catalogd HA failover have a loop of the following pattern: - Do some operations - Kills the active catalogd - Verifies some results - Starts the killed catalogd After starting the killed catalogd, the test gets the new active and standby catalogds and check their /healthz pages immediately. This could fail if the web pages are not registered yet. The cause is when starting catalogd, we just wait for its 'statestore-subscriber.connected' to be True. This doesn't guarantee that the web pages are initialized. This patch adds a wait for this, i.e. when getting the web pages hits 404 (Not Found) error, wait and retry. Another flaky issue of these failover tests is cleanup unique_database could fail due to impalad still using the old active catalogd address even in RPC failure retries (IMPALA-14228). This patch adds a retry on the DROP DATABASE statement to work around this. Sets disable_log_buffering to True so the killed catalogd has complete logs. Sets catalog_client_connection_num_retries to 2 to save time in coordinator retrying RPCs to the killed catalogd. This reduce the duration of test_warmed_up_metadata_failover_catchup from 100s to 50s. Tests: - Ran all (15) failover tests in test_catalogd_ha.py 10 times (each round takes 450s).
